At Bush Hill Park station, ticketing is made easy with services available from Monday to Friday, 06:45 to 10:00. You’ll find both manned ticket offices and self-service ticket machines, complete with accessible options. The station features step-free access in parts, particularly important for wheelchair users and those with heavy luggage. The southbound platform can be accessed from St Mark's Road, and the northbound from Queen Anne's Place. However, it's important to note that full platform interchange requires a journey via the street.
While there aren't any smartcard services presently available, there's an induction loop for the hearing impaired and accessible toilets that ensure a comfortable visit for all. There are waiting rooms available with provided seating areas, open from 06:45 – 20:00 Monday to Friday, and slightly reduced hours on Saturday.
For those planning onward journeys, Bush Hill Park station is surrounded by a wealth of transport options. Local bus services by Transport for London operate just outside the station, ensuring seamless connectivity whether you're heading north to Enfield Town or south towards Liverpool Street. If a rail replacement service is in order, simply use Bus Stop B for northbound services and Bus Stop A for southbound.
If you're one to cycle, the station is equipped with cycle racks on platforms 1 and 2 for convenience, although cycle hire isn't available at this station. Car parking is readily available, operated by National Car Parks Ltd, and while you’ll find 37 regular spaces, there are two spaces dedicated for accessible parking needs.

Though a quaint and modest station, Gypsy Lane is equipped with essential facilities that ensure an easy travel experience. Ticket machines are available where you can collect tickets purchased online or in advance. These machines are designed to be accessible to everyone, including those requiring mobility support. Although there's no ticket office or staff assistance directly at the station, help is available via the helpline.
For your security, CCTV operates throughout the station, offering peace of mind as you await your train. However, facilities such as to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ment centers, and car parking are not available. So, it's a good idea to come prepared!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with two cycling spaces available.
Pondering on how to get to or from Gypsy Lane? Although the station itself does not have direct bus services or taxi ranks, alternative travel options are easily accessed. Rail replacement services pick up and drop off at Cypress Road Bus Stops, conveniently located adjacent to the Brunton Arms pub. If you're thinking of getting a taxi, you can explore options online via services like Cab4You. Unfortunately, bus services are not available in close proximity to the station.
